‘All options on the table’ to address youth crime in Tasmania following spate of alleged incidents
Premier Jeremy Rockliff says “all options are on the table” to address youth crime in Tasmania, including considering following Queensland’s lead to allow youth offenders found guilty of serious offences to be tried as adults.
